How many soldiers did the Russian army lose?

The Pentagon believes that the large number of Russian soldiers killed in the war in Ukraine could undermine their will to continue fighting.

Axar.az informs this was reported by The New York Times.

"American intelligence estimates that 7,000 Russian soldiers died in the war. That's more than the total number of American soldiers killed in 20 years during the wars in Iraq and Afghanistan. However, sources say that the information about the dead may be inaccurate. In total, more than 150,000 Russian servicemen are involved in the war.

It is noted that as the Russian army is in a state of confusion, they are increasingly attacking Ukrainian cities, houses, hospitals and schools.
